Careers Across the Post‑16 Education Sector

Post‑16 education supports learners from a wide range of backgrounds and life stages. Careers exist across multiple settings, including:

 

  • Further Education (FE) colleges
  • Higher Education (HE) institutions
  • Training providers and skills organisations
  • Adult and community learning
  • Secure and offender learning environments

Across these settings, roles extend beyond teaching and lecturing to include training, assessment, learner support, professional services and leadership.
